Standby Underwriting Agreement
A contract where the underwriter commits to buy any shares not purchased by investors during an initial public offering (IPO) or secondary offering.
Unsubscribed Portion
That part of a new issue of securities not taken up or purchased by investors during an offering period.
Ex-Rights Date
The first trading day when a security is offered for sale in the marketplace without the entitlement to a previously declared rights offering.
Rights Offering
An option for existing shareholders to buy additional shares directly from the company at a pre-determined price, usually at a discount, as a way to raise capital.
